Why did Justin Timberlake postpone his show?

Justin Timberlake had to postpone his Forget Tomorrow World Tour show in Newark, New Jersey, on October 8 due to an injury. He shared the news with his fans via Instagram, expressing his disappointment and apologizing for not being able to perform. Timberlake wrote, “I’m so sorry to postpone tonight’s show. I have an injury that’s preventing me from performing. I’m so disappointed to not see you all, but I’m working to reschedule ASAP. I promise to make it up to you and give you the show y’all deserve,” accompanied by a broken heart emoji.

He expressed gratitude to his fans for their understanding and support, signing off as JT.

Despite this setback, Timberlake has been enjoying the tour, which began in April to promote his sixth studio album, Everything I Thought It Was. At his recent performance at the Barclays Center in Brooklyn on October 7, he created a memorable moment by helping a fan propose to his girlfriend, Sarah, after spotting a sign in the audience that read, “May I propose to Sarah?” The crowd cheered as the proposal unfolded on stage.

Just a few days before the postponement, Timberlake celebrated his 12th wedding anniversary with Jessica Biel during his Montreal show, acknowledging her presence and joking with the audience to be nice to her because she was sharing him with them. Biel later shared the moment on her Instagram Story, expressing her joy in spending the day with Timberlake.

Timberlake is set to perform in Philadelphia on October 11 and in Washington D.C. on October 13.
